Possess the Land

Today's Scripture

See, I set before you today life and prosperity, death and destruction. For I command you today to love the LORD your God, to walk in obedience to him…then you will live and increase, and the LORD your God will bless you in the land you are entering to possess. Deuteronomy 30:15–16, NIV


Even though the first generation of Israelites that came out of slavery in Egypt had seen great miracles and were finally free, they turned back from entering the Promised Land when they saw the fortified cities and giants. They believed the wrong story that God would not make them victorious, that they always would be a defeated people. They came out of Egypt, but Egypt never came out of them.

Forty years later, the second generation had a different story. Their attitude was that they were going to see the fulfillment of today’s Scripture. They would not let their doubts, their fears, or the opposition rewrite their story and keep them in the wilderness. They saw themselves as sons and daughters of the Most High God. They were going to enjoy the abundance and blessings that their parents could have had. Don’t do as their parents did and let a wrong story—what you’ve been through, what looks too big—convince you that you can’t defeat your giants, you can’t accomplish your dream, or you can’t be healthy, successful, and fulfilled.

A Prayer for Today

“Father, thank You that You are always greater than any difficulty or adversity I will ever face. Thank You that my story is not that of a defeated slave, but I am well able to go in and take possession of the land. I believe that You are going to help me defeat giants and strongholds. In Jesus’ Name, Amen.”

Abounding Grace

Today's Scripture

But where sin abounded, grace abounded much more. Romans 5:20, NKJV


You haven’t superseded your allotment of grace. You haven’t made a mistake so big that God ran out of mercy. Instead of living condemned, why don’t you go boldly to the throne of God and receive that grace and forgiveness. God is waiting to gladly welcome you. But here’s the key: He won’t force you to come. In Luke 15, the compassionate father didn’t make the prodigal son return home. It was the young man’s choice after allowing sin to abound in his life. When he took steps to return to his father, his father came running with grace and mercy that was much more abounding.

When we feel the guilt and condemnation, we have to know that grace abounds much more. God sees our failures already covered by Jesus’ blood. Now we have to receive the forgiveness and see ourselves without fault. When you became a child of the Most High God, He made you worthy. You are the righteousness of God. It’s not your righteousness; it’s His righteousness. Lift your head and see yourself as God sees you.

A Prayer for Today

“Father, thank You that I have been freely justified by Jesus’ redemption and that Your grace is abounding in me. Thank You that the power of Your grace rules over where sin has abounded in my life. I believe that Your grace has no limits. In Jesus’ Name, Amen.”

Unequaled Greatness

Today's Scripture

Praise him for his mighty works; praise his unequaled greatness! Psalm 150:2, NLT


You realize just how limited you are, but God is unlimited. We’re natural, but He’s supernatural. When you don’t see a way out, you’ll be tempted to complain. No, turn it around and praise Him for who He is. “Lord, praise You that You’re bigger than this sickness. Praise You that You’re stronger than this addiction. Praise You that You’re greater and more powerful than this trouble or these people.” You could be sending up doubt, defeat, and complaints, but you’re bragging on the goodness of God and sending up praise that sets miracles into motion. That’s when God will show up and do what you cannot do.

Sometimes we’re waiting for circumstances to change, then we’ll give God praise, then we’ll have a good attitude, but that’s backward. You have to praise God first. You have to have that song in your heart when nothing is changing. God is still on the throne. Keep thanking Him that He’s working. Keep declaring that you’re coming through this. Let every breath you take be with praise to the Lord.

A Prayer for Today

“Father, thank You that You are unequaled in greatness and worthy of my highest praise. Thank You that You reign over all the circumstances of my life and that You are with me. As long as I have breath, I will praise You and believe You are defeating the challenges in my life. In Jesus’ Name, Amen.”

You Are Very Powerful

Today's Scripture

Solomon son of David took firm control of his kingdom, for the LORD his God was with him and made him very powerful. 2 Chronicles 1:1, NLT


At the start of this new year, you may be facing situations that look too big. The opposition is too strong, the dream too great. It’s easy to have a weak mentality, to feel intimidated, as though you’re at a disadvantage. This is probably the way Solomon felt when his father, David, died. David was an amazing leader who had conquered nations and defeated giants. Solomon wasn’t a warrior king like his father, but he was suddenly thrust into this position. I’m sure he was tempted to shrink back and think, “This is too much. I can’t lead a nation.” But today’s Scripture says that he took firm control of the kingdom, for the Lord was with him and made him very powerful.

You may see yourself as limited, not enough, less-than, but the Lord your God is with you. He has made you not just powerful, but very powerful. What you’re up against may be big, but it’s no match for you. The same power that raised Christ from the dead lives in you. You’re not ordinary. You’re not common. You are very powerful.

A Prayer for Today

“Father, thank You that every force of the enemy was broken when Jesus rose from the dead. Thank You that You have given me Your power and that there will be no situation in this coming year that is too big or opposition too strong. I declare that You have made me very powerful. In Jesus’ Name, Amen.”

Give Ear To

Today's Scripture

“My sheep listen to my voice; I know them, and they follow me.” John 10:27, NIV


How many times is God speaking to us throughout the day but we’re not sensitive to it? Perhaps it’s just a whisper, “Slow down on the freeway. Be kinder to your spouse. Call your friend and give her some encouragement. Turn off the computer and get some more sleep. Take care of yourself.” Gentle whispers. They’re not loud. God is not going to force you to do it. It’s just an impression. The word “obey” in the original language means “give ear to.” To be obedient, you have to give your ear to what God is saying. You have to be a listener. Be sensitive to the whisper. What are you feeling in your spirit? It may not be words, just a knowing deep down of what you’re supposed to do. Other voices, thoughts, reasonings, and people’s opinions will be much louder, but you have to learn to give the whispers the most attention. When you let the still small voice be the voice you follow, you’ll make the best decisions.

A Prayer for Today

“Father, thank You that You speak to me throughout my day in gentle whispers in my spirit. Help me to give ear to what You are saying rather than push it down or ignore it. I will listen to Your still small voice and obey. In Jesus’ Name, Amen.”

Built Any Altars Lately?

Today's Scripture

Jacob built an altar there and named the place El-bethel (which means “God of Bethel”), because God had appeared to him there when he was fleeing from his brother, Esau.Genesis 35:7, NLT


As Jacob did in today’s Scripture, we can all look back in life and see times when God made a way. We knew it was His hand that protected us from a car crash, promoted us when we didn’t deserve it, brought us through a loss. Those weren’t just coincidences. In the Old Testament, when these things happened, people took time to build an altar to thank God for what He had done. They would look back at those altars, and that was fuel for their faith. They knew that if He did it back then, He would do it again.

We should still be building altars today. It’s easy to get so busy that we don’t recognize the blessing of God. But when you take time to acknowledge what God has done, you recognize He brought you safely through a sickness, gave you that person to love, opened a door that’s taken you further than you ever imagined. When you pause to say, “God, I recognize this is Your goodness. Thank You for Your favor and mercy,” that’s building an altar.

A Prayer for Today

“Father, thank You for the strength that rises within me whenever I remember what You have done in my life. Thank You for the countless times You made a way when it seemed there was no way and You opened doors that seemed closed. I will build my altars and remember Your goodness. In Jesus’ Name, Amen.”

Do You Want What You’re Saying?

Moses had led the Israelites out of slavery to the border of the Promised Land. God had promised they would defeat their enemies and live in abundance. They had this great report of victory, but then the other report from ten spies said the enemy was too big and powerful. Rather than believe God, the Israelites let fear dominate their thoughts, and they begin to complain against Him. “We’ll never get in. We’re going to die out here in the desert.” It’s significant that God answered them and said, “I will do exactly what I heard you say. You will all die in the desert.” They didn’t realize that by speaking it out, they were prophesying their future.

If God were to do exactly what you’re saying today, would it be what you want? Are you speaking victory, health, abundance, freedom, and new levels? Or are you talking about how big the giants are, what you’ve been through in the past, how you can’t accomplish your dreams or break an addiction? Don’t let tongue trouble keep you out of your promised land.

A Prayer for Today

“Father, thank You that You are always greater than any difficulty or adversity I will ever face. Thank You that You are listening as I declare that, based upon Your promise, I am well able to go in and take the land. I believe that You are going to bring me to the next level. In Jesus’ Name, Amen.”

Take Your Promised Land

Today's Scripture

They answered Joshua, “We will do whatever you command us, and we will go wherever you send us.” Joshua 1:16, NLT


When God brought the Israelites out of slavery and took them to the Promised Land, He promised that all they had to do was go in and take the land. But the Israelites were too afraid of the people in the land and turned away. They spent forty years in the desert running from things that God promised they could conquer. The next generation of Israelites came back to the Promised Land, saw the same giants and fortified cities, but had a different attitude. They refused to spend their lives wandering in the desert. They declared to Joshua that they would do whatever he commanded, face the opposition, and take the same land their parents could have had.

Don’t be like the Israelites and spend years of your life running from things God has already given you victory over. You may need to confront pride, confront a bad attitude, or confront compromise. When you face your fears, defeat bad habits, or forgive the wrongs and hurts others have caused, you will enter your promised land. The victory is already yours.

A Prayer for Today

“Father, thank You that You are the Most High God and that no giant or stronghold is too great for You. Thank You that You are leading me into my promised land as I confront and face areas of my life that have held me back. Help me to be bold to take my promised land. In Jesus’ Name, Amen.”
